Main news
Main news refers to the primary news stories or reports that are considered significant and relevant to the public at a given time. These stories typically cover major events, developments, or issues that have widespread interest or impact, such as political events, natural disasters, economic changes, or social issues. Main news is often distinguished from less critical or specialized news, focusing instead on topics that affect a large audience. The term is commonly used in media outlets, including newspapers, television, and online platforms, to highlight the most important or breaking stories that are deserving of attention.
